I own an LP2 and have never heard the Lux. I took at look at it though and it’s very similar in some ways. Tube rectified, which is a must for me, low output level for MM so you can use a Decca cartridge if you want. But they are two different beasts in terms of control. The Lamm has none. That’s a problem for some but hasn’t been for me, both with my Decca Super Gold and a Denon DL103. They sound great at whatever the Lamm preset is (I think you can order what you want). I also own a Lamm preamp and I have been in this hobby for 30 years and I’ve never been happier nor more content. Hope this helps a bit in your decision making. There probably is no wrong choice.
